npm install出粗
时间: 2024-04-16 22:22:53 浏览: 12
当我们在使用npm install命令时,有时候可能会遇到一些错误或者出现粗。这些问题可能是由于网络连接问题、依赖包版本冲突、权限问题等引起的。以下是一些常见的npm install出粗的解决方法:
1. 检查网络连接:首先确保你的网络连接正常,可以尝试使用其他网络或者重启网络设备。
2. 清除npm缓存:运行以下命令清除npm缓存:
```
npm cache clean --force
```
3. 更新npm版本:有时候旧版本的npm可能会导致一些问题,可以尝试更新npm到最新版本:
```
npm install -g npm@latest
```
4. 检查依赖包版本冲突:如果你的项目中存在依赖包版本冲突,可以尝试手动修改package.json文件中的依赖版本,或者使用npm-check或者yarn等工具来解决依赖包版本冲突。
5. 检查权限问题:如果你在安装全局包时遇到权限问题,可以尝试使用管理员权限运行命令行或者在命令前加上sudo(适用于Mac和Linux系统)。
6. 使用镜像源:有时候npm官方源可能会因为网络问题导致下载速度慢或者出现其他问题,可以尝试使用其他镜像源,如淘宝镜像、cnpm等。
以上是一些常见的解决方法,希望能帮助到你。如果还有其他问题,请随时提问。
相关问题
node husky install
As an AI language model, I cannot perform installations on your system. However, I can provide you with information about the "node husky install" command.
The "node husky install" command is used to install the Husky Git hooks for a Node.js project. Husky is a tool that allows developers to automate tasks and enforce code quality standards by running scripts before specific Git commands are executed.
To use Husky in your project, you need to have Node.js and Git installed on your system. Once you have these dependencies installed, you can run the following command to install Husky:
```
npm install husky --save-dev
```
After installing Husky, you can configure Git hooks by adding scripts to the package.json file of your project. For example, to run a pre-commit hook that checks for lint errors, you can add the following script:
```
"scripts": {
"pre-commit": "npm run lint"
}
```
This script will run the "lint" command before every commit, and if there are errors, the commit will be aborted.
To activate the Git hooks, you can run the following command:
```
npx husky install
```
This will create a .husky directory in your project, which contains the Git hooks. Now, when you run Git commands, Husky will automatically execute the scripts that you have defined.
vue3 xlsx如何将表头加粗
你可以使用 `xlsx-style` 库来设置表头的样式,其中包括加粗等。
首先安装 `xlsx-style`:
```
npm install xlsx-style --save
```
然后在代码中引入:
```javascript
import XLSX from 'xlsx-style'
```
接下来创建一个样式对象:
```javascript
const headerStyle = {
font: {
bold: true
}
}
```
最后在生成 Excel 文件时,将该样式对象传递给表头单元格的 `s` 属性:
```javascript
const worksheet = XLSX.utils.json_to_sheet(data)
worksheet['!cols'] = [{ width: 15 }, { width: 20 }, { width: 25 }]
worksheet['A1'].s = headerStyle
```
以上代码将第一列的宽度设置为 15,第二列的宽度设置为 20,第三列的宽度设置为 25,并将第一行的样式设置为 `headerStyle`。
注意:`xlsx-style` 的使用方法与 `xlsx` 略有不同,详细使用方法可以参考它的文档。